I visited Riding Mountain National Park for a couple of days hoping to take a few pictures of elk and moose which sadly I didn't come across one. However, the black bear made quite the appearance. They were grazing on grass and dandelions along some of the roads that pass through the park. There was no shortage of black bears I am guessing they will disappear into the forest once the leaves and berries are more plentiful.
